Intern Variant Curation Scientist information
What does an intern variant curation scientist do?
An Intern Variant Curation Scientist assists with the analysis and interpretation of genetic variants, often working with large genomic datasets. Their main role is to review and classify genetic variants according to established guidelines to help determine their potential impact on health. This involves literature research, data annotation, and collaboration with senior scientists. The position provides hands-on experience in genetic data analysis and exposure to clinical genomics workflows.
What types of projects and responsibilities can an intern variant curation scientist expect during their internship?
As an Intern Variant Curation Scientist, you can expect to work closely with experienced scientists and bioinformaticians to evaluate genetic variants using databases, published literature, and established guidelines. Your daily tasks may include reviewing genetic data, annotating variants, and contributing to clinical reports or research projects. Interns often participate in team meetings, collaborate on data interpretation, and may even help improve curation processes or pipelines. This role provides hands-on exposure to genetic diagnostics and offers valuable insights into the workflow of clinical genomics teams.
What are the key skills and qualifications needed to thrive as an intern variant curation scientist, and why are they important?
To thrive as an Intern Variant Curation Scientist, you need a solid background in genetics, molecular biology, and bioinformatics, often supported by coursework or training in these areas. Familiarity with genomic databases, variant interpretation tools (such as ClinVar and ACMG guidelines), and data analysis software is typically required. Strong analytical thinking, attention to detail, and effective communication skills help in interpreting complex data and collaborating within research teams. These competencies are crucial for ensuring accurate genetic variant classification and supporting impactful clinical or research outcomes.

Who We Are
Persona AI is building humanoid robots for the most demanding environments in heavy industry - shipyards, steel mills, fabrication facilities, and offshore platforms - performing welding, grinding, maintenance, inspection, and material-handling work that is dangerous, physically demanding, and increasingly difficult to staff.
We are backed by leading strategic and financial investors and engaged with global industrial leaders across Korea, Japan, the United States, and Singapore. Korea is the center of gravity for our early commercial strategy, anchored by relationships with the world's leading shipbuilders and steelmakers. Our work spans both the robot platform itself and the systems, partners, and playbooks required to deploy it at scale.
We're looking for an Autonomy Software Engineering Intern to help build the world modeling layer of our autonomy stack. You will work hands-on with NVIDIA Cosmos3, curating real-world industrial video data from our customer facilities and fine-tuning models to give our humanoid robots a grounded understanding of the environments they operate in.
This is a paid summer internship based in Houston, TX. You will report to the Behavior Coordination Lead and work directly with the autonomy team alongside our machine learning, perception, and simulation engineers.
Your Role
- Design and implement autonomy and behavior coordination algorithms for an industrial humanoid platform
- Work with manipulation, locomotion, and perception engineers to integrate robot skills into autonomous robot behaviors
- Implement data curation pipelines that enable our robots to understand a variety of real-world industrial tasks.
- Develop synthetic data generation pipelines for post-training of humanoid world models
- Design and implement pipelines for autonomous behavior evaluation, benchmarking, and regression testing
- Turn raw industrial video footage (shipyards, steel fabrication, welding cells) into structured, high-quality training data.
- Design and evaluate reasoning benchmarks that measure how well a fine-tuned world model grounds language queries in real shipyard and fabrication-plant scenes.
We're Looking For
- Currently pursuing a BS, MS, or PhD in Robotics, Computer Science, Machine Learning, Electrical Engineering, or a related field; recent graduates are also welcome.
- Hands-on experience training, fine-tuning, or evaluating modern deep learning models in PyTorch.
- Strong Python skills; comfortable writing data processing scripts, training loops, and evaluation harnesses.
- Working familiarity with at least one vision-language model, large language model, or video understanding model.
- Practical experience building data pipelines: ingestion, filtering, labeling workflows, deduplication, train/val/test splits.
- Comfortable working in Linux environments with Git, containers (Docker), and cloud GPU infrastructure.
- Self-directed and able to make steady progress on an open-ended research problem with weekly check-ins rather than daily direction.
Preferred or Bonus Qualifications
- Direct experience with NVIDIA Cosmos or comparable world foundation models.
- Exposure to NVIDIA Isaac Sim, Omniverse, or OpenUSD for synthetic data generation and scene variability.
- Familiarity with humanoid or mobile-manipulator robotics, ROS/ROS 2, and the broader autonomy stack.
- Experience with motion capture data, egocentric video capture, or first-person dataset construction.
- Exposure to behavior trees, task and motion planning, or LLM-driven planning architectures.
- Familiarity with NVIDIA Isaac Lab, NIM microservices, or the Hugging Face training ecosystem.
- Prior internship, research, or open-source work on physical AI, embodied reasoning, or robot learning.
